I'm not sure about your question. Is something like this what you want?

Colored table entries

\documentclass{article}
\usepackage{amssymb,pifont,booktabs,caption,fixltx2e}
\usepackage[flushleft]{threeparttable}
\usepackage{xcolor}

\usepackage{multirow}

\newcommand{\ok}  {\textcolor{green}{\ding{51}}}
\newcommand{\fail}{\textcolor{red}  {\ding{55}}}

    @Ahmad. "It's not working" doesn't provide too much information, but if you need to resize your table I'd suggest using \resizebox command (from graphicx package) or a tabularx instead of tabular to lay your table. You'll find several examples in TeX.SX. – Ignasi Apr 29 '14 at 10:01
